On Fri, May 16, 2014 at 02:12:44PM -0400, Brian Foster wrote: > Hi all, > > This is an rfc to get some discussion rolling on sysfs support for XFS. > The motivation for this work is here: > > http://oss.sgi.com/archives/xfs/2014-05/msg00381.html All the sysfs magic for this looks pretty ugly. Why can't we just dump it into debugfs given that it's very much a debug only feature anyway? It would also be really nitfy to have a tool to fronted it in the style of xfs_db and xfs_io.. |
